** The bathroom remodeling market for residents of Literberry, IL, is served by contractors from nearby larger towns like Jacksonville and the broader Central Illinois region. Due to the rural nature of the area, the market is not saturated with a high volume of competitors, which places a premium on established, reputable local companies with a proven track record. The competition level is moderate, with a few long-standing, family-owned businesses dominating the local reputation.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in this region can range from **$10,000 for a basic update** to **$25,000+ for a high-end, custom renovation with layout changes and accessibility features**. The quality of service is generally high among the top-rated providers, as they rely heavily on word-of-mouth and community referrals to sustain their business. Homeowners are advised to get multiple quotes and verify local references due to the significant investment involved.

For a full remodel in our area, homeowners can expect a range of $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the size of the bathroom, material selections, and scope of plumbing/electrical work. Illinois labor costs and material availability influence this range, and opting for locally sourced materials like tile from regional distributors can help manage expenses. It's crucial to get a detailed, written estimate from your contractor that accounts for Literberry's specific supply chain logistics.
Literberry's temperature extremes necessitate specific considerations to ensure durability and comfort. We strongly recommend installing in-floor radiant heating to combat cold tile floors in winter and choosing ventilation fans rated for Illinois' high summer humidity to prevent mold and mildew. Selecting materials like porcelain tile that withstand freeze-thaw cycles and humidity swings is also essential for long-term performance.
Yes, most bathroom remodels in Literberry will require permits from the Village or Menard County, especially for plumbing, electrical, and structural changes. Illinois plumbing code and local ordinances govern drain lines, venting, and GFCI outlet placement. A reputable local contractor will handle this process, ensuring your project meets all codes, which is vital for your safety, insurance, and future home resale value.
While interior work can be done year-round, late spring through early fall is often ideal for scheduling, as it avoids potential delays from severe winter weather affecting material deliveries. A full remodel typically takes 3 to 6 weeks from demolition to completion. Planning ahead is key, as local contractor schedules in our region can fill up quickly, so we recommend initiating consultations several months in advance of your desired start date.
Always verify an Illinois contractor holds an active license through the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ation (IDFPR). For Literberry specifically, ask for proof of local business registration and request references from recent projects in Menard or surrounding counties. A trustworthy contractor will also carry general liability and workers' compensation insurance to protect your home, which is a non-negotiable requirement.
